Stampeders expecting Ticats to bring the intensity CFL
“They’re going to be desperate,” said Stamps quarterback Jake Maier. “They’re obviously super well-coached and they have an identity and they’ve been in the Grey Cups the last two seasons, so you’ve got to respect that regardless of where they’re at in the season and their record.Article content
The Stamps have booked their spot in the playoffs, but with rumours of Lions QB Nathan Rourke possibly being ready to play against by the end of the month it would definitely be beneficial to secure a home game in the West Division Semifinal – even if the Stampeders have arguably played better on the road this year.Article content
Adding to the intrigue on Friday night will be the last game these two teams played against each other. While there’s only so much that should really be taken from the Stamps’ mid-June overtime win over the Ticats — it was four months ago, after all — it was a huge moment in both teams’ seasons.Article content“That first half, you’re just like ‘This isn’t us’ and then that second half is what we showed all year,” said Stamps defensive tackle Derek Wiggan.
